How much does it cost to rent a home in Brighton?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Brighton 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,393 | $1,425 | $8,400 |
Brighton 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,203 | $1,050 | $10,000+ |
Brighton 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,863 | $975 | $10,000+ |
Brighton 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,787 | $950 | $10,000+ |
Brighton 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$6,832 | $825 | $10,000+ |
Brighton 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,168 | $950 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Brighton
What type of rentals are currently available in Brighton?
There are currently 13532 Apartments for Rent in Brighton, MA with pricing that ranges from $850 to $50,000. There are also 9059 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Brighton ranging from $825 to $40,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Brighton?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Brighton ranges from $825 to $40,000 with an average monthly rent of $4,260.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Brighton?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Brighton range from $1,200 to $15,000,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,050 to $12,800.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$975 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$850.
